Observed the pump off when arrived. The pump is operating with a timer and was not scheduled to turn the pump on until early afternoon. A pool recirculation system must operate 24 hours per day and not use a timing device unless the timing device only reduces the flow by 25% and a full turnover is achieved prior to the pool being opened.
Rule .07(1) (c) Timing devices will be allowed for the purpose of turning down the circulation system
during times when a pool is not being used. Timing devices must be set to provide at
least one complete turnover immediately prior to the pool reopening.
Observed pressure gauge broken and not functional on the filter. Replace the pressure gauge.
Light is missing in the small pool area. The empty niche causes a hazard in the pool. Replace the light so there is not a hazard in the pool.

Both doors were propped open upon arrival. The main entrance was propped on the lock hasp. When it is moved the door then is stopped from closing by the pin at the bottom of the door striking the base plate. Once this door is fully closed, it will not re-open due to the pin at the bottom of the door getting stuck in the base plate because the push bar on the door dues not function properly. Repair this door and secure/remove hasp so the door will automatically close and latch every time. The rear door was propped open with on the pic at the bottom of the door hitting the base plate of the door frame. If the push bar is pushed the door will latch. Repair this door so that it will automatically close and latch.
Throw rope is missing from the life ring. Life ring needs a 24' rope attached. Attach 24' rope to life ring. Rope can not exceed 50'. The throw rope is in the pool area but not attached to the life ring. Keep rope attached to the life ring.
Observed float rope not in pool. Keep float rope in place across pool.

Both doors were propped open upon arrival. The main entrance was propped on the lock hasp and the rear door was propped open with a rock. Do not prop doors open.
Free chlorine observed at 0ppm. The allowable range is 2ppm-10ppm. Raise chlorine to within allowable range.
Float rope not in pool. Keep float rope in place across pool.
